BOOK  ONE   "WHEN ROSES BLOOM"

Kate Grady and Alexander Fraser fall in love in a Canadian pioneer sugar bush but The Great Fire of 1870 pulls them apart to live in different worlds filled with dangerous adventures while they lead very different lives. But fate brings them together again 15 years later where they must decide if they can overcome new obstacles and begin a new life together in London

BOOK  TWO    "A CIRCLE OF ROSES"

Can artist India Selkirk, new in Thornebury, and Laurie Fraser, the handsome village vet, really have lived before as Kate Grady and Alexander Fraser, as an old prophesy had promised? Similar problems from the past arise as they get to know each other, but just as they are foraging a tenuous connection, people start to die, as someone uses poisons to lethal effect.
